Protocol Action Testing

Action

Protocol Action Testing, within the context of cryptocurrency, options trading, and financial derivatives, represents a systematic evaluation of how a protocol responds to specific, predefined events or stimuli. This testing goes beyond simple unit tests, encompassing complex interactions between smart contracts, oracles, and external systems. The objective is to validate the protocol’s behavior under various conditions, including edge cases and potential attack vectors, ensuring robustness and predictable outcomes. Successful implementation of this testing framework is crucial for maintaining trust and integrity within decentralized systems.